Diverse approaches to group fitness programs serve individuals with different interests and abilities. Classes can range from vigorous interval workouts (HIIT) to yoga, dance, or even outdoor fitness camps. Each type of class offers unique advantages and attracts various tastes. For example, some may enjoy the energetic environment of a dance session, while others may favor the tranquility of yoga. By providing choices, fitness centers can attract a broad spectrum of participants, creating an welcoming space where everyone feels welcome.
In addition to physical exercise, group fitness training often include aspects of teamwork and companionship. Attendees are encouraged to assist one another throughout workouts, celebrating milestones and persevering through challenges together. This feeling of connection can greatly enhance the workout session. Participants often form relationships that carry beyond the gym, resulting in a more united community overall. As people bond in classes, they may also inspire each other to maintain a regular exercise routine.
